#7bbb60 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7bbb60 is composed of 48.2% red, 73.3%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.7%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 102.2 degrees, a saturation of 40.1% and a lightness of 55.5%. #7bbb60 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ffc0 with #007700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#7bbb60 color description : Slightly desaturated green.
#7bbb60 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7bbb60 has RGB values of R:123, G:187,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 8108896.

Shades and Tints of #7bbb60
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040603 is the darkest color, while #f8fcf7 is the lightest one.
